Epitaph

Erected by Annie Grills in memory of her beloved husband Galbraith Hamilton Grills, son of W. E. Grills, Louth, and grandson of Sir J. J. Burgoyne, Tyrone, and late chief of Fiver Coastguards of Portrush drowned 1sr Nov 1889 by capsizing of lifeboat whilst endeavouring to rescue crew in distress aged 49. Our dearly loved mother Annie Grills died 13th October 1903 aged 61.
